WebDeformities of the wrist are usually operated on around 6 months of age. Ulnar clubhand. An ulnar clubhand is less common than a radial clubhand. This deformity may involve underdevelopment of the ulnar bone (the bone in the forearm on the side of the little finger), or complete absence of the bone. WebJun 16, 2016 · Thalassemia bone disease includes a heterogeneous group of conditions that includes bone deformity, pain, marrow expansion, reduced bone density, and fractures . Panel: Bone ‣ Deform. The Deform panel. In this panel you can set deformation options for each bone. Toggling the checkbox in the panel header off, prevents the bone from deforming the geometry at all, overriding any weights that it might have been assigned before; it mutes its influence.
